Martínez’s Absence Alarms Al Taawoun Before Al Ettifaq Roshn League Match
Al Taawoun faces a significant hurdle ahead of their upcoming showdown with Al Ettifaq in the Saudi Roshn League. The team will be without Argentine striker Roger Martínez, who has been ruled out due to an accumulation of yellow cards. His absence not only affects the team’s attacking capabilities but also impacts their strategy moving forward.
Impact of Martínez’s Absence
Martínez has played a crucial role for Al Taawoun this season. He leads the team’s scoring charts and is a contender for the prestigious Roshn League Golden Boot. Losing such a key player before a vital match poses a serious challenge for Al Taawoun’s coach and technical staff.

Recent Performance of Both Teams
The stakes are high for both sides as they prepare for their clash. Al Ettifaq arrives at this match full of confidence after a recent win against Al Ittihad, which has boosted their league positions significantly. On the other hand, Al Taawoun is looking to build on their recent success over Al Riyadh to solidify their standings in the upper tier of the league.
